Über Roter Veltliner
Roter Veltliner is an ancient Austrian white grape, one of the parent varieties of Grüner Veltliner, producing full-bodied, complex wines with nutty, honey, and citrus notes. It is cultivated mainly in the Wagram and Weinviertel regions.
